Output d95be12ba0f412be7079954f93f52c5d12e0a79b61953c29ea1a3a482ba8874a:20

value
79033459
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3d749bd2801c1cd5893bf2a647bc494c7ec606a8 OP_EQUAL
address
37HxqMkY8hStYDzEvFo7Mh2tuw7i2n9Dvf
transaction
d95be12ba0f412be7079954f93f52c5d12e0a79b61953c29ea1a3a482ba8874a